DEFB1

Gene
Defb1
Protein
Beta-defensin 1
Organism
Mus musculus
Length
69 amino acids
Function
Has bactericidal activity. May act as a ligand for C-C chemokine receptor CCR6. Positively regulates the sperm motility and bactericidal activity in a CCR6-dependent manner. Binds to CCR6 and triggers Ca2+ mobilization in the sperm which is important for its motility.
Similarity
Belongs to the beta-defensin family.
Mass
7.749 kDa

Gene
DEFB1
Protein
Beta-defensin 1
Organism
Chinchilla lanigera
Length
67 amino acids
Function
Has antibacterial activity against Gram-positive bacterium S.pneumoniae Serotype 14. Is also active against Gram-negative bacteria M.catarrhalis 1857, and non-typeable H.influenzae strains 86-028NP and 1128. Has antifungal activity against C.albicans. May have a role in maintaining sterility in the middle ear (PubMed:14996845). May act as a ligand for C-C chemokine receptor CCR6. Positively regulates the sperm motility and bactericidal activity in a CCR6-dependent manner. Binds to CCR6 and triggers Ca2+ mobilization in the sperm which is important for its motility (By similarity).
Similarity
Belongs to the beta-defensin family.
Mass
7.676 kDa
